Performance and Battery Life: Power and Endurance

The Galaxy S21 FE is powered by the Qualcomm Snapdragon 888 processor, a powerful chipset that ensures seamless performance for demanding tasks and applications. The Galaxy Z Flip 4, on the other hand, is equipped with the Qualcomm Snapdragon 8+ Gen 1 processor, which offers improved performance and power efficiency. Both devices come with 8GB of RAM and offer various storage options. In terms of battery life, the Galaxy S21 FE houses a 4,500mAh battery, while the Galaxy Z Flip 4 packs a 3,700mAh battery. The S21 FE generally offers longer battery life due to its larger battery capacity, but the Z Flip 4’s more power-efficient processor helps offset the difference.
